Does grip tape on a lacrosse stick make it easier to cradle?
Im pretty new at lax, but it seems to be harder to cradle with gloves on my stick, which has no grip, then when im just playing without gloves. I can cradle either way, but the ball just falls out more when I am using gloves. If I got grip tape to put on stick, would it make it easier?
depends on the shaft.
say your compareing having something like a swizzbeat or swizzle compared to something else thats just plain out alluminum.
if the shaft feels good and has good grip on it(you will know if it feels like that) then you will barely need any grip tape besides on the butt.
but some people put one small strip of grip tape for where there hands will be when they pass or shoot.
those tapes arnt for grip its just for a guide to know where your comfort spot is.
